草庐IT

java - 如何修复列索引超出范围 SQLException

当我传递查询时,出现以下错误。ErrornoisNilErrorStringIsQueryProblem.....java.sql.SQLException:ColumnIndexoutofrange,2>1.这是我的java方法中的代码。PreparedStatementpstm=con.prepareStatement("selectperiodfromstu_attendancemasterwhereclassid=?andabsentdt>=?andabsentdt 最佳答案 此语句中有错误:PreparedStatemen

mysql - 如何上线修复命令行中的错误? MySQL控制台

我真的很认真地看了很久,难道真的没有办法在不重新输入我的查询的情况下上一行来修复拼写错误吗?我在Windows7上使用MySQL控制台。如果没有,我应该用什么来学习MySQL? 最佳答案 使用\e将允许您通过在文本编辑器中打开它来编辑命令edit(\e)Editcommandwith$EDITOR.http://dev.mysql.com/doc/refman/5.7/en/mysql-commands.html 关于mysql-如何上线修复命令行中的错误?MySQL控制台,我们在Sta

mysql - 如何修复蛋糕烘焙控制台中的错误 "PHP Fatal error: Call to undefined function mysql_query() "

这个问题在这里已经有了答案:Whyshouldn'tIusemysql_*functionsinPHP?(14个答案)关闭25天前。我在很多地方都看到过这个错误,但确实如此。我在运行蛋糕烘焙控制台时遇到此错误,就在选择C“Controller”然后选择默认数据库配置之后我通过Virtualbox在Ubuntu10.10上我正在使用xampp-并通过命令apt-getinstallcakephp安装了cakephp这里是错误UseDatabaseConfig:(default/test)[default]>PHPFatalerror:Calltoundefinedfunctionmysq

Mysql数据库修复

我的服务器几乎没有问题(托管已满,忘记了mysql密码等)现在当我检查phpmyadmin时一切正常我只有information_schema/mysql/performance_schema/phpmyadmin数据库可用。但是我想访问位于/etc/mysql/mydb的数据库,不知道如何通过phpmyadmin访问它?mydb文件夹仅包含.ibd+.frm文件 最佳答案 在从一台机器上移动表(或数据库)时,您必须遵循这些规则。迁移工作可能存在异常(exception)情况,但听起来它们不适用于您的情况。相同版本的MySQL/Ma

php - MySQL修复两个表中的自动增量差距

我有两个这样的表;id_imagefoobar13528131788714238129id_imagebarfoo12315621811210123821317817295071148102682734第一个表中自动递增的id_image有一个间隙。在第二个表中,id_image引用了第一个表中的id_image,每个ID都有两个。注意:此表是理论上的。我不知道差距到底在哪里,或者是否有多个差距。我所知道的是第一个值为1,最后一个值高于总行数。现在,我想弥补这个差距。在您说差距无关紧要之前,如果确实如此,那就是糟糕的数据库设计,让我告诉您;我同意你的看法。但是,我正在处理的是一个(无可

mysql - 如何修复 InnoDB 损坏,从创建中锁定表名(errno : -1) on AWS RDS?

提示:不要在MySQLWorkbench中为“标准TCP/IPoverSSH”连接运行ALTER语句。最好进入服务器并从那里运行ALTER。这样,如果您失去与服务器的连接,ALTER仍应完成其工作。我正在尝试在我昨天尝试创建的数据库中创建一个新表。问题是,我的互联网一直在微辍学中失去连接。我相信这些故障之一是在我创建表时发生的,现在当我尝试创建一个具有完全相同的名称的表时:CREATETABLEIFNOTEXISTS`adstudio`.`data_feed_param`(`id`BIGINTUNSIGNEDNOTNULLAUTO_INCREMENT,PRIMARYKEY(`id`))

mysql - 如何修复 "Variable ' sql_mode'无法设置为 'NULL'的值”错误

我有这张表:#Dumpingstructurefortableeditz.to_importCREATETABLEIFNOTEXISTS`to_import`(`id`int(11)unsignedNOTNULLauto_increment,`reference`int(11)unsignedNOTNULL,`trackid`int(11)unsignedNOTNULL,`side_pos1`char(2)NOTNULL,`side1`varchar(255)NOTNULL,`pos1`char(2)NOTNULL,`hh1`char(2)NOTNULL,`mm1`char(2)NOT

mysql - 删除其中一些后修复 mysql 表行 id 中的空白

这个问题在这里已经有了答案:Howtohandlefragmentationofauto_incrementIDcolumninMySQL(5个答案)关闭2年前。我有一个mysql表,其中有超过17000行。我从它的中间部分删除了大约530行。现在每一行都有一个连续的AUTO-INCREAMENTED数字主键。正如您现在所理解的那样,行的几个数字已被删除。所以我只是想问一下,有没有办法以某种完美的顺序再次修复所有行?

mysql - 如何修复 "InnoDB: Failed to find tablespace for table X in the cache. Attempting to load the tablespace with space"

Mysql不工作,我得到以下错误:[ERROR]InnoDB:Failedtofindtablespacefortable'"database"."table"'inthecache.Attemptingtoloadthetablespacewithspaceid1290. 最佳答案 我今天在将数据目录从一台服务器复制到另一台服务器时遇到了类似的问题,我要发布的答案可能不是直接的。我错误地在我的配置文件中添加了innodb_force_recovery选项,这就是错误的原因,innodb_force_recovery值被设置为5。删

php - 如何修复消息 : SQLSTATE[08004] [1040] Too many connections

我正在使用下面的代码连接数据库classDatabaseextendsPDO{function__construct(){try{parent::__construct(DB_TYPE.':host='.DB_HOST.';dbname='.DB_NAME,DB_USER,DB_PASS);$this->setAttribute(PDO::ATTR_ERRMODE,PDO::ERRMODE_EXCEPTION);$this->setAttribute(PDO::MYSQL_ATTR_INIT_COMMAND,"SETNAMES'utf8'");}catch(PDOException$e